- Understand the Root Cause:
To overcome procrastination, it’s essential to identify the underlying reasons behind it. Consider these common causes and reflect on your own situation:
a. Fear of Failure: The fear of making mistakes or not meeting expectations can lead to avoidance.
b. Lack of Clarity: Unclear goals and a vague sense of direction can make it challenging to prioritize tasks.
c. Perfectionism: Striving for perfection can create paralysis and hinder progress.

Effectively managing your time can help combat procrastination. Consider adopting these techniques:
a. Pomodoro Technique: Break your work into 25-minute focused sessions (pomodoros) with short breaks in between.
b. Time Blocking: Allocate specific time blocks for different tasks, ensuring focused attention on each.
